The FootJoy Men's FJ Fuel Golf Shoe impresses with its combination of functionality and style. The easy-to-clean synthetic upper is perfect for golfers who want to keep their shoes looking pristine without much effort. The Stratolite EVA midsole offers superior cushioning, helping to mitigate the stresses of walking over the golf course's undulating terrain.
The patented Stability Bridge is a standout feature, enhancing your stability and support throughout your swing. This is especially beneficial for maintaining balance and control when executing shots. Additionally, the Pro|SL inspired outsole technology gives you unparalleled grip, ensuring each step feels secure across different surfaces.
For those seeking comfort, the LASER SPORT LAST fits effectively across the forefoot and instep while providing a slightly narrower heel. This helps maintain a snug fit, particularly for athletes actively moving around the course. However, it's worth noting that players with wider feet might find this shoe less accommodating.
In terms of aesthetics, the white/black/orange color scheme is both eye-catching and contemporary, making these shoes suitable for both casual and competitive play. Bought these for use during driving range sessions. I was impressed with the overall looks and the comfort (for me, at least) is excellent; having rather narrow feet, that was especially important. If there is one area where I was rather disappointed, it is the composition of the sole: it feels like some kind of TPU or urethane-based compound rather than a rubber-like one. This means two things: one, it's rather hard to the touch, as it lacks the flexibility of a rubber-like compound, and two, walking on any surface other than grass is slippery. My apartment building has terrazzo floors in the lobby and I can see sliding there if I'm not careful. I came to FJ from Adidas shoes, which use rubber-like soles with excellent grip on all surfaces, so this was a major letdown for me.Of course, if you're only using these at the golf course and not wearing them there (as I do) then you'll have no issue, but I felt it needed mentioning. It's also possible that after a few wearings it would gain grip, so we'll see.
